Community digs deep at Alberton Crossing fundraiser for Stepping Stone Hospice

Stepping Stone Hospice thanked the community for making the fundraiser a success in support of children facing life-limiting illnesses.

Locals came in numbers to McDonald’s Alberton Crossing on May 4 to turn a meal into a moment of meaningful giving.

From 14:00 to 17:00, 10% of all sales made at a marked till were donated to Stepping Stone Hospice for children battling life-limiting illnesses.

The Hospice children’s unit mascot, Victor, also made an appearance.

To support this initiative, families, friends and supporters had to buy a share box or any large meal and McCafe treats.

All proceeds will support Stepping Stone Hospice’s vital work in providing palliative care and emotional support to young patients and their families.
